Debenhams

The brand Debenhams was one of the most well-known brands on the Great British high street. It was founded 1818, and its first store was outside of London. The company grew rapidly by purchasing Knightsbridge retailer Harvey Nichols in 1928.

Belinda Earl, as chief executive of the company, was instrumental in guiding the company to expand in the late noughties. Earl launched the cult Designers at Debenhams label, which featured top fashion designers selling items at Debenhams' prices. She also made the first steps towards international expansion, opening stores in Bahrain and Kuwait.

However the company was in financial trouble. In 2022, the last Debenhams stores had closed, and the company was sold to the online rival Boohoo. The sale has left behind vacant retail units in town centres, which are difficult to repurpose. Fortunately, some have been converted into residential or co-working spaces. A lot of these spaces remain vacant. This is due to the fact that less Britons are shopping in stores. People who do shop are buying more items for the home and clothes online.
